The 2012 Wisconsin high school football season kicks off just days from now and the AP preseason rankings were just released. The rankings are voted upon by sports writers from across the state and are arranged into three divisions based on enrollment size. First place votes are in parenthesis. LARGE DIVISION (enrollment 900+)

1. Waunakee (7)

2. Hartland Arrowhead (1)

3. Brookfield Central (1)

4. Sun Prairie

5. Verona Area

6. Sussex Hamilton

7. Marshfield

8. Kenosha Bradford

9. Franklin

10. Monona Grove

No surprise with the three-time defending Divsion 2 state champion Waunakee at the top. They are clearly the team to beat this year. I am surprised last year’s Divison 1 runner-up Wisconsin Rapids-Lincoln did not crack the top ten. Look for them to be contenders once again this year.

MEDIUM DIVISION (301-899)

1. West DePere (8)

2. Walworth Big Foot (1)

3. Waukesha Catholic Memorial

4. Kewaskum

5. Brown Deer

6. Plymouth

7. Wisconin Lutheran 

8.  Waupaca

9. Pewaukee

10. Cedar Grove

From top to bottom, no surprises here. Somerset, who lost a thriller in double overtime last year in the Division 4 championship game, will wind up in the top ten by the end of the season.

SMALL DIVISION (300 and lower)

1. Fond du Lac Springs (9)

2. Colby

3. Edgar

4. Eau Claire Regis

5. Potosi

6. Stratford

7. Blackhawk

8. Lancaster

9. Shiocton

10. Hurley

The small division is stacked. Any team ranked in the top ten can easily win a state championship this year. Lancaster will slowly creep up the ladder and Edgar and Stratford will be neck and neck all year and their collision in Week 5 could be a playoff preview.
